Calm in the Storm Storms will come in life, but in Acts 27, Paul faced a literal, physical storm at sea. Still, he was calm and trusted in God. This activity is simple, but requires true conversation. Ask your children how they can grow in their trust for God in times when things are easier, so that they can face difficult times in life and still trust God. You need to be willing to share some struggles from your own life, and how you saw God at work and remained trusting in Him.
